Drainage ditch repair services involve fixing and restoring existing ditches that are designed to manage water flow on a property. These services typically include clearing out blockages, repairing erosion damage, reshaping the ditch to ensure proper slope and flow, and reinforcing the banks to prevent future deterioration. Skilled service providers use specialized tools and techniques to restore the ditch’s function, helping to direct water away from structures and prevent unwanted pooling or flooding during heavy rains or snowmelt.

Many problems can arise when drainage ditches become compromised. Over time, heavy rainfall or snow can cause erosion, leading to collapsed banks or uneven water flow. Blockages from debris or sediment buildup can obstruct water movement, resulting in standing water or localized flooding. These issues can threaten the stability of nearby foundations, damage landscaping, and create muddy, unsafe conditions. Repairing a drainage ditch ensures that water can flow freely and safely through the property, reducing the risk of water-related damage and maintaining proper drainage.

Properties that typically benefit from drainage ditch repair include residential homes, farms, commercial buildings, and land parcels with significant grading or landscaping features. Homes situated on slopes or in areas prone to heavy rainfall may require regular maintenance or repairs to their drainage systems. Agricultural properties often rely on properly functioning ditches to prevent waterlogging and protect crops. Commercial properties with extensive landscaping or parking areas also depend on effective drainage solutions to avoid flooding and maintain safe access for visitors and employees.

The overview below groups typical Drainage Ditch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Wasilla, AK.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Most routine drainage ditch repairs in Wasilla typically cost between $250 and $600. These include fixing minor erosion, clearing blockages, or patching small sections, which are common projects for local contractors.

Moderate Repairs - More involved repairs, such as replacing damaged sections or addressing moderate erosion, generally fall in the $600-$1,500 range. Many projects in this category are completed within this band, though some larger repairs may cost more.

Major Repairs - Extensive work like significant excavation or comprehensive reinforcement can range from $1,500 to $3,500. Larger, more complex projects tend to push into the higher end of this spectrum, but fewer jobs reach the upper tiers.

Full Replacement - Complete drainage ditch replacement projects, especially in challenging terrains, can cost $3,500 or more. These are less common but necessary for severely damaged or outdated systems, with costs varying based on scope and site conditions.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of drainage ditch repairs do local contractors handle? Local contractors can address issues such as erosion repair, blockage removal, lining damaged sections, and restoring proper water flow in drainage ditches.

How can drainage ditch problems affect property in Wasilla, AK? Poorly maintained or damaged drainage ditches can lead to water pooling, soil erosion, and potential flooding, impacting property stability and landscaping.

What signs indicate a drainage ditch needs repair? Signs include standing water, sediment build-up, visible erosion, or water flowing outside the intended ditch path.

Are there different repair methods used for various drainage ditch issues? Yes, techniques vary from simple cleaning and blockage removal to installing new liners or reshaping the ditch to ensure proper drainage.

How do local service providers ensure effective drainage ditch repairs? They evaluate the site, identify the root cause of issues, and use appropriate repair methods to restore proper water flow and prevent future problems.
